Du vet mitt namn men inte min historia : en studie om utländska akademiker och deras möte med den svenska arbetsmarknaden

Kadic, Amar January 2016 (has links)
Studiens syfte var att undersöka utländska akademikers upplevelser av mötet med, och inträdet på, den svenska arbetsmarknaden. Studiens frågeställningar: Vilka hinder kan försvåra etableringen på arbetsmarknaden för utländska akademiker? Vilka faktorer kan främja etableringen på arbetsmarknaden för utländska akademiker? Den teoretiska utgångspunkten för studien är hämtad utifrån socialkonstruktivism samt begreppet etnicitet som social konstruktion. Studien är genomförd med kvalitativ forskningsmetod, vilken utfördes med hjälp av semistrukturerade livsvärldsintervjuer. Analysmetoden för studien var IPA (Interpretative Phenomenological Analysis), där gemensamma teman lyftes fram och diskuterades utifrån de teoretiska utgångspunkterna. I resultatavsnittet har studiens frågeställningar besvarats enligt följande: Hinder som kan försvåra etableringen av utländska akademiker på arbetsmarknaden är samhällets föreställningar, sociala kategoriseringar, etnisk diskriminering, strukturella förändringar på arbetsmarknaden samt arbetsgivarnas inflytande. Sammanfattningsvis skildrade studiens resultat hur viktigt det är att belysa att de föreställningar som finns i samhället gällande personer med utländsk bakgrund påverkar synen på individen. Dessa faktorer var de mest centrala elementen och kärnan i det empiriska materialet kopplat till denna frågeställning. De främjande faktorerna till etableringen av utländska akademiker enligt studiens resultat är: Delaktighet, personligt ansvarstagande och betydelsen av utbildning. I enhet med respondenternas upplevelser framgår vikten av att samma anställningskriterier ska gälla för alla oberoende av ens bakgrund eller tillhörighet. Även personligt ansvarstagande visade sig vara betydelsefullt, exempelvis individens egen motivation, styrka och inre resurser. Vidare betonas att det finns tendenser till att samhällets syn på utländska personers resurser är i förändring. Detta på grund av det växande behovet av mångkulturell arbetskraft med flerspråkighet, kulturell kompetens samt akademisk utbildning, med anledning av den stora flyktinginvandring som pågår just nu. Studiens resultat har både gått i linje med tidigare forskning samt gått emot eller visat nya infallsvinklar på tidigare forskningsresultat. / The purpose of this study was to investigate foreign academics' experiences of meeting with, and entry to the Swedish labor market. Study questions: What obstacles could hamper the establishment of the labour market for foreign graduates? What factors can promote the formation of the labour market for foreign graduates? The theoretical starting point for the study is taken on the basis of social constructivism and the concept of race as a social construction. The study was conducted with qualitative research, which was conducted using semi-structured interviews, life-world. The analytical method for the study was the IPA (Interpretative Phenomenological Analysis), where common themes were highlighted and discussed from the theoretical points. In the results section, the study questions were answered as follows: Obstacles that can hinder the establishment of foreign graduates in the labour market is society's beliefs, social categorizations, ethnic discrimination, structural changes in the labour market and employers' influence. In summary, the study's results depicted how important it is to highlight that the perceptions that exist in society concerning people with foreign backgrounds affect the perception of the individual. These factors were the key elements and the core of the empirical material related to this issue. The promotion factors to the establishment of foreign graduates according to the study's results are: Involvement, personal responsibility and the importance of education. The unit with the respondents' experience illustrates the importance of the recruitment criteria should apply to all, regardless of one's background or affiliation. Although personal responsibility proved to be important, such as the individual's own motivation, strength and inner resources. They also stress that there are tendencies that society's view of foreigner's resources is changing. This is because of the growing need for multicultural workforce with multilingualism, cultural competence and academic training, due to the large influx of refugees that is going on right now. The study results have both been in line with previous research, and gone against or demonstrated new angles on previous research.

Language of Instruction and Puerto Rican First Graders' Ethnic Categorizations

Marichal, Margarita 01 January 2018 (has links)
The use of subtractive bilingual models in Puerto Rico may influence children's construction of social categorizations. There is a gap in the literature related to linguistics, ethnicity, and systems of education and acculturation of a majority group. The purpose of this multiple case study was to examine the influence of the language of instruction and teachers' communicative practices in private and public schools on first graders' ethnic identity construction in the municipality of San Juan, Puerto Rico. The conceptual framework of the study was based on Markus's unified theory of race and ethnicity, Berry's bidimensional model of acculturation, Tajfel and Turner's social identity theory, and Wimmer's ethnic boundaries multilevel process theory. The research questions concerned how teachers' communicative practices reflected and promoted children's construction of social categorizations, what roles teachers played in ethnic education, and the influences that shaped their cultural knowledge. Purposeful sampling was used to select 2 Spanish speaking and 2 English speaking classrooms form the municipality that could provide information to answer the research questions. Data were collected from classroom observations, structured interviews with teachers, analysis of classroom artifacts, and the use of Zea, Asner-Self, Birman, and Buki's Abbreviated Multidimensional Acculturation Scale. Data were coded and then categorized by theme. The findings of the study demonstrated that teachers' hybridized ethnicity is reflected in communicative practices that influenced children's construction of social categorizations. This study could serve to develop strong cultural awareness policies for education systems and for other countries at risk of losing their language and traditions.

Att förmedla kön : En retorisk studie av könskonstruktioner i Arbetsförmedlingens rekryteringsmaterial rörande mans- och kvinnodominerade yrken / To transmit gender : A rhetorical study of gender constructions in the Swedish Employment Service's recruitment material regarding male- and female dominated professions

Logge, Jessica January 2020 (has links)
This rhetorical study aims to investigate how gender constructions are produced and reproduced through linguistic and symbolic expressions. Thus, there has been interest in analyzing recruitment films from the state authority – The Swedish Employment Service – primarily regarding male- and female dominated professions to gain knowledge of how they work to maintain or challenge perceptions of gender and gender equality in the labor market. In order to examine this, I have used Kenneth Burke's theory of identification, Judith Butler's theory of gender and performativity together with Mats Landqvist's terms, social categorizations and intersectional perspective. I found that gender is constructed differently depending on whether it is male- or female constructed. In addition, the analysis shows that women are associated with values ​​such as health, care and looks while men are represented with attributes as tough, muscular and elderly. The comparison between the artifacts showed that all recruitment films create identification bases that appeal to young people and usually to both genders regardless of occupation. The overall purpose of the essay and what I hope to convey is knowledge of how gender-dominated professions differ and work to change the view of gender.
